# Model Pipelines | ||
|
||
Ansible AI Connect is becoming feature rich. | ||
|
||
It supports API for the following features: | ||
- Code completions | ||
- Content match | ||
- Playbook Generation | ||
- Role Generation | ||
- Playbook Explanation | ||
- Chat Bot | ||
|
||
"Model Pipelines" provides a mechanism to support different _pipelines_ and configuration for each of these features for different providers. Different providers require different configuration information. | ||
|
||
## Pipelines | ||
|
||
A pipeline can exist for each feature for each type of provider. | ||
|
||
Types of provider are: | ||
- `grpc` | ||
- `http` | ||
- `dummy` | ||
- `wca` | ||
- `wca-onprem` | ||
- `wca-dummy` | ||
- `ollama` | ||
- `llamacpp` | ||
- `nop` | ||
|
||
### Implementing pipelines | ||
|
||
Implementations of a pipeline, for a particular provider, for a particular feature should extend the applicable base class; implementing the `invoke(..)` method accordingly: | ||
- `ModelPipelineCompletions` | ||
- `ModelPipelineContentMatch` | ||
- `ModelPipelinePlaybookGeneration` | ||
- `ModelPipelineRoleGeneration` | ||
- `ModelPipelinePlaybookExplanation` | ||
- `ModelPipelineChatBot` | ||
|
||
### Registering pipelines | ||
|
||
Implementations of pipelines, per provider, per feature are dynamically registered. To register a pipeline the implementing class should be decorated with `@Register(api_type="<type>")`. | ||
|
||
In addition to the supported features themselves implementations for the following must also be provided and registered: | ||
- `MetaData` | ||
|
||
A class providing basic meta-data for all features for the applicable provider. | ||
|
||
For example API Key, Model ID, Timeout etc. | ||
|
||
|
||
- `PipelineConfiguration` | ||
|
||
A class representing the pipelines configuration parameters. | ||
|
||
|
||
- `Serializer` | ||
|
||
A class that can deserialise configuration JSON/YAML into the target `PipelineConfiguration` class. | ||
|
||
### Default implementations | ||
|
||
A "No Operation" pipeline is registered by default for each provider and each feature where a concrete implementation is not explicitly available. | ||
|
||
### Lookup | ||
|
||
A registry is constructed at start-up, containing information of configured pipelines for all providers for all features. | ||
``` | ||
REGISTRY = { | ||
"http": { | ||
MetaData: <Implementing class>, | ||
ModelPipelineCompletions: <Implementing class> | ||
ModelPipelineContentMatch: <Implementing class> | ||
ModelPipelinePlaybookGeneration: <Implementing class> | ||
ModelPipelineRoleGeneration: <Implementing class> | ||
ModelPipelinePlaybookExplanation: <Implementing class> | ||
ModelPipelineChatBot: <Implementing class> | ||
PipelineConfiguration: <Implementing class> | ||
Serializer: <Implementing class> | ||
} | ||
... | ||
} | ||
``` | ||
|
||
To invoke a pipeline for a particular feature the instance for the configured provider can be retrieved from the `ai` Django application: | ||
``` | ||
pipeline: ModelPipelinePlaybookGeneration = | ||
apps | ||
.get_app_config("ai") | ||
.get_model_pipeline(ModelPipelinePlaybookGeneration) | ||
``` | ||
The pipeline can then be invoked: | ||
``` | ||
playbook, outline, warnings = pipeline.invoke( | ||
PlaybookGenerationParameters.init( | ||
request=request, | ||
text=self.validated_data["text"], | ||
custom_prompt=self.validated_data["customPrompt"], | ||
create_outline=self.validated_data["createOutline"], | ||
outline=self.validated_data["outline"], | ||
generation_id=self.validated_data["generationId"], | ||
model_id=self.req_model_id, | ||
) | ||
) | ||
``` | ||
The code is identical irrespective of which provider is configured. | ||
